How much is a return flight from Birmingham to Northern Ireland?

This analysis is based on the cheapest return trip price found on KAYAK in the last 12 months by searching for a flight from Birmingham to Northern Ireland departing in September.

Flight prices are below average for this route right now.

Flights to Northern Ireland from Birmingham usually cost between £80 and £128 in September.
The lowest price found in the past 5 days was £51 on easyJet (5 Sept–6 Sept).

What is the cheapest month to fly from Birmingham to Northern Ireland?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Birmingham to Northern Ireland,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Birmingham to Northern Ireland is January, when tickets cost £71 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are August and July, when the average cost of return tickets is £110 and £103 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Birmingham to Northern Ireland?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Birmingham to Northern Ireland,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below-average price on a flight from Birmingham to Northern Ireland, you should book around 4 weeks before departure, which saves you about 33% compared to booking last-min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 11 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Birmingham to Northern Ireland?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ional return ticket. You could then fly from Birmingham to Northern Ireland with an airline and back with another airline.
